SECTION 5 ELECTRICAL ADJUSTMENTS
Notes: 1. CD block basically constructed to operate without adjustment. Therefore, check each item in order given. 2. Use YEDS-18 disc (Part No.: 3-702-101-01) unless otherwise indicated. 3. Use the oscilloscope with more than 10 M� impedance. 4. Clean an object lens by an applicator with neutral detergent when the signal level is low than specified value with the following checks. Procedure: 1. Connect the oscilloscope to TP2 (FE) and TP (VC) on BD board. 2. Connect the TP3 (FEI: IC101 pin @ª) and TP (VC) with lead wire. 3. Turned power switch on. 4. Put disc (YEDS-18) in and turned power switch on again and actuate the focus search. (actuate the focus search when disc table is moving in and out.) 5. Confirm that the oscilloscope waveform (S-curve) is symmetrical between A and B. And confirm peak to peak level within 3.0 ± 1.0 Vp-p.

Procedure: 1. Connect the oscilloscope to TP1 (RFO) and TP (VC) on BD board. 2. Turned power switch on. (stop mode) 3. Put disc (YEDS-18) in and press the ( button. 4. Confirm that the oscilloscope waveform is clear and check RF signal level is correct or not. Note: Clear RF signal waveform means that the shape ��� can be clearly distinguished at the center of the waveform.

Procedure: 1. Connect the frequency counter to TP13 (XPLCK). 2. Turned power switch on. 3. Put disc (YEDS-18) in and press the ( button. 4. Confirm that the reading on frequency counter is 4.3218 MHz.
